Vintomas wrote: 91 points
November 2, 2016 - Elegant nose with citrus, some peach, mineral, flowers, and tiny hints of herbs and aromatic oils. The palate is dry, citrus in the attack, rather high acidity, a mid-palate that is dominated by mineral notes (with the fruit coming in the background) and a viscous impression, followed by some foody bitterness, and a long mineral-dominated aftertaste with some bitterness. Still youngish and could probably develop more, 91(+) p.
The wine shows a lot of breeding, "GG character" and concentration, although the best GGs tend to show more citrus notes on the palate. (Apparently, some of the single vineyard wines ended up in this wine in 2013 due to small harvests, so it punches above its weight in this vintage.) Although the acidity is highish, it isn't quite as high and green apple-styled as in many other German 2013s. -
